The "application for ignition interlock history" refers to a formal request submitted to a relevant authority—usually within a state's public safety department or a similar regulatory body—to obtain records related to an individual's use of an ignition interlock device. These devices are typically mandated by court orders for those convicted of driving under the influence of alcohol. The application serves to gather comprehensive data regarding compliance, violations, and device installation duration. This form is a critical tool, often used in legal situations to verify adherence to DUI penalties and to ensure public safety standards are met.
To effectively use the application, individuals should first identify the appropriate government agency that manages the ignition interlock program in their state. Typically, this will be the state's Department of Public Safety or equivalent. Users should ensure they have all relevant personal information and documentation ready, such as their driver's license number and court documents outlining the ignition interlock requirement. This information will assist in filling out the application accurately. Once the form is completed, it can be submitted either online or via mail, depending on the specific state’s process. Understanding these steps helps in successfully accessing one's ignition interlock history.
Gather Required Information: Start by collecting all necessary personal details, including identification numbers and any court-related documents.
Access the Application: Obtain the form from the appropriate state agency's website or office. Ensure you have the latest version of the application.
Fill Out the Form: Accurately complete each section, providing truthful and precise details about your history and the duration of the interlock device usage.
Attach Supporting Documents: Include any additional documentation that supports your application, making sure everything is legible and well-organized.
Submission: Submit the application either through the agency's online portal or by mailing it to the designated address. Confirm receipt to ensure processing begins.
Await Confirmation: After submission, wait for the agency to process the application and provide the ignition interlock history report.

The primary users of this application include individuals who have been mandated to use an ignition interlock device following a conviction for driving under the influence. Legal professionals and probation officers also frequently request these histories to assess compliance with court-ordered penalties. Furthermore, insurance companies might use these histories to determine risk levels and adjust policies accordingly. Each stakeholder relies on this comprehensive historical data to make informed decisions based on compliance and violation records.


In a legal context, the application for ignition interlock history serves as evidence of a driver’s compliance with DUI penalties. It is critical in proceedings related to the reinstatement of driving privileges, contested license suspensions, or additional penalties for non-compliance. The documented history within the report can support arguments made by defense attorneys or prosecutors. Furthermore, this application upholds transparency and accountability, contributing to safer driving conditions by ensuring lawful adherence to ignition interlock programs.

Since ignition interlock policies can vary significantly from state to state, applicants must familiarize themselves with the specific rules applicable to their region. For instance, the Oklahoma Board of Tests requires strict adherence to reporting violations to their Department of Public Safety. Similarly, states may have different criteria for what constitutes a violation, timeframes for device installation, and processes for applying for history documentation. Understanding these nuances ensures compliance and helps prevent any delays in processing the application.
